A clergyman of the name of Bishop was batting one day in a local cricket match. On the bowler sending him a very, wide ball, he called out • Keep the ball in the parish, sir.' The very next ball took his middle stump, whereon the bowler remarked,' I think that's about the diJcese, my Lord.'
